Record-Breaking Price Movement
On 12 August 2026, Silver Touch Technologies Ltd’s stock price surged to an intraday high of Rs.219.70, setting a new 52-week and all-time high. The stock opened with a notable gap up of 3.61%, signalling strong buying interest at the start of the trading session. Despite a slight pullback by the close, with a day’s change of -0.19%, the stock maintained its position near the peak, underscoring the resilience of its upward trajectory.
The day’s high represented a 6.37% increase from the previous close, while the stock’s performance remained broadly in line with its sector peers. This milestone comes after four consecutive days of gains, highlighting a sustained bullish trend in recent trading sessions.

Valuation and Financial Metrics
At the current price of Rs.206.15 (as of 09:35 AM on 12 August 2026), Silver Touch Technologies Ltd trades at a price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io of 63x on a trailing twelve months (TTM) basis. The price-to-book value (P/BV) stands at 15.53x, while the enterprise value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) multiple is 37.10x. Other valuation multiples include an EV/EBIT of 42.45x and an EV/sales ratio of 7.36x, reflecting a premium valuation consistent with the company’s growth profile.
The PEG ratio of 0.77x suggests that the stock’s price growth is reasonably aligned with its earnings growth, indicating a balanced valuation perspective. Dividend metrics reveal a modest yield of 0.02%, with the latest dividend declared at Rs.0.05 per share and a payout ratio of 2.86%. The ex-dividend date is scheduled for 19 August 2025.
Quality and Growth Indicators
Silver Touch Technologies Ltd is classified as an average quality company based on its long-term financial performance. The management risk is assessed as average, while growth and capital structure receive excellent ratings. The company has demonstrated a healthy five-year sales comp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 25.21% and an impressive five-year EBIT growth of 56.73%.
Financial leverage remains low, with an average debt to EBITDA ratio of 0.69 and net debt to equity at 0.12, indicating a strong balance sheet. The average return on capital employed (ROCE) is a solid 19.00%, although return on equity (ROE) is relatively weaker at 13.92%. The company maintains an adequate interest coverage ratio of 10.54x, supporting its financial stability.
Recent Financial Trends
Short-term financial trends as of June 2026 are positive. Quarterly profit before tax (excluding other income) rose sharply by 126.60% to ₹13.12 crores, while net profit after tax (PAT) increased by 147.3% to ₹9.99 crores. Net sales for the quarter grew by 23.45% to ₹78.02 crores, reflecting strong operational performance. The half-year ROCE reached a peak of 27.12%, further highlighting efficient capital utilisation.
However, the quarterly earnings per share (EPS) was noted as ₹0.79, marking the lowest point in recent periods, which may warrant monitoring in future financial disclosures.
